However, tough challenges are ahead for the city’s industry and trade sector. They come from the curtailment of industrial production as most of the large production facilities move out of the central city, and limited investment in high-tech industry and weak development of supporting industry. Chinese man sentenced 18 months in prison due to illegal entry into Vietnam
In September, 2019, Wang Qing Lin illegally entered Vietnam to work. One month later, Lin was fined VND4 million (USD173.91) for not completing the necessary entry procedures as required. After returning to China, Wang Qing Lin was told by a man named Xiao Hua to join the online visual stock market. Being promised to receive the monthly payment of CNY5,000, Lin agreed with the deal. On November 9, 2019, Wang Qing Lin illegally entered Vietnam again by road through an unidentified man. After re-entering Vietnam, Wang Qing Lin was taken to the central city of Danang by a Vietnamese person who has not yet been identified. In Danang City, with the support of Nguyen Thi Yen, 26 and Le Thi Toan, 38, Wang Qing Lin stayed in different areas in the city. During the stay in Danang, Wang Qing Lin used his mobile phones, iPads and laptops to operate an illegal visual stock website in China. Biti’s – a Vietnam Value Programme honoured “Journeys will lead you home” messages
With seven main branches across the country, 156 stores, and more than 1,500 sales intermediates, Biti’s have created more than 9,000 jobs and the annual output of 20 million pairs of shoes. In China, Biti’s established four offices, 30 distribution of commodities, and 300 sales points.
